The injury occurred during Barcelona's recent La Liga match against Leganés, where the team suffered a 0-1 defeat. Yamal was subjected to a heavy challenge in the 17th minute, which impacted his right ankle—a region previously injured in November, causing him to miss several matches. Although he attempted to continue playing, his discomfort was evident, leading to his substitution in the 75th minute.
As a result of this setback, Yamal is projected to miss several crucial fixtures. He will be unavailable for the upcoming La Liga match against Atlético Madrid on Saturday, December 21. Additionally, his participation in the Copa del Rey encounter against Barbastro on January 4, 2025, is doubtful. The club remains hopeful that he will recover in time for the Spanish Super Cup semifinals against Athletic Club on January 8, 2025.
This injury compounds Barcelona's recent challenges, as the team has experienced a dip in form, securing only one victory in their last six league matches. The absence of Yamal, who has been a pivotal figure in their attacking lineup, presents an additional obstacle as they strive to regain momentum in both domestic and international competitions.
